How to Install and Uninstall libparu0 Package on Kali Linux

Last updated: May 20,2024

1. Install "libparu0" package

Please follow the steps below to install libparu0 on Kali Linux

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install libparu0

2. Uninstall "libparu0" package

This is a short guide on how to uninstall libparu0 on Kali Linux:

$ sudo apt remove libparu0 $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ove

Description: unsymmetric multifrontal multithreaded sparse LU factorization
Suitesparse is a collection of libraries for computations involving
sparse matrices.
.
ParU is an implementation of the multifrontal sparse LU factorization
method. Parallelism is exploited both in the BLAS and across different frontal
matrices using OpenMP tasking, a shared-memory programming model for modern
multicore architectures. The package is written in C++ and real sparse matrices
are supported.
